Output eb21d5062786d5a59ece2a15f42c21abe3da7f668bdf80f157364619af3c747e:0

value
22604031
script pubkey
OP_0 OP_PUSHBYTES_20 8e3262f05bc11e1506698c776b147bfd8fa77954
address
ltc1q3cex9uzmcy0p2pnf33mkk9rmlk86w725q3rw6k
transaction
eb21d5062786d5a59ece2a15f42c21abe3da7f668bdf80f157364619af3c747e
spent
true